JCI Regatta traces its roots back to the humble beginnings at Santa Maria Parish Church, where its founders laid the groundwork for establishing the local organization.
In 2009, National President Fulbert Woo, JCI Iloilo President Rex Chua, and Charter President Elmer Usi invited members of the Santa Maria Parish and their network of young individuals to join what would become one of the most awarded JCI chapters in Western Visayas.

The tradition of excellence has been a cornerstone of the organization since it started. No less than its founding President Elmer J. Usi is an academic achiever since his elementary to college and outstanding student leader. He first joined JCI Bacolod in 1995. As a new member, he established the Talisay Jaycee Chapter Extension, the Junior Jaycees of La Salle Bacolod and lead numerous advocacies. His active leadership led him to be awarded as 1995 Area 4 Most Outstanding New Jaycee and JCI Philippines Merit Award for Most Outstanding New Jaycee. The culture and vision of excellence of President Elmer Usi was brought to JCI Regatta when established the chapter in 2009. His sterling leadership together with the board of director led the chapter to be recognized as the Best New Local Organization in the 2011 JCI Asia Pacific Conference. JCI Regatta was also recognized as JCI Asia Pacific’s Best Community Development Project for Pinoy Icon.
JCI-Regatta, established in Iloilo in 2009, derives its name from the Paraw Regatta Festival and strives to promote Iloilo, the festival, and cultivate leaders for positive community impact.
JCI-Regatta empowers members through diverse opportunities in Business & Entrepreneurship, International Cooperation, Individual Development, and Community Impact, engaging in leadership development, local and international conferences, fundraisers, community projects, and conventions and competitions, fostering personal growth and societal awareness.
JCI-Regatta welcomes Ilonggos aged 18 to 40, driven by vision and compassion, believing in their capacity to create impactful community change.
